In this talk Andrew gives his interpretation of the traditional “four seals” as discussed in the classic book by Uchiyama on Soto Zen: Opening the Hand of Thought. The four seals are:
1. Life is suffering.
2. Impermanence.
3. No substantial self (interdependence).
4. Nirvana (the end of suffering).
The four seals are the essentials for a teaching to be Buddhism. They are what differentiates Buddhism from other religions.
